That ending features alex renouncing his violent past and promising to try to be a good man. He grows bored with violence and recognizes that human energy is better expended on creation than destruction, explained burgess. The implication of the ending of the movie is that the politicians were willing to let alex be his old self again, as long as it made them (temporarily) look good (not to mention that they used alex's conditioning and. Burgess penned a clockwork orange with the intention that it would run 21 chapters, a number significant in that it was the age of legal adulthood at the time. A clockwork orange is a dystopian satirical black comedy novel by english writer anthony burgess, published in 1962.
